Basic information Supplier

2065187-09-7(1-(benzo[d]thiazol-2-yl)-1-(naphthalen-2-yl)pent-4-en-1-ol)

Basic information Supplier
2065187-09-7 Basic informationMore

Browse by Nationality 2065187-09-7 Suppliers >China suppliers

Recommend You Select Member Companies